| Sensitivity | Hygroscopic;air and moisture sensitive |
|---|---|
| Boil Point(°C) | 128 °C/0.1 mmHg |
| Melt Point(°C) | 106 °C |
| Molecular Weight | 151.210 g/mol |
| XLogP3 | 1.500 |
| Hydrogen Bond Donor Count | 0 |
| Hydrogen Bond Acceptor Count | 1 |
| Rotatable Bond Count | 1 |
| Exact Mass | 151.1 Da |
| Monoisotopic Mass | 151.1 Da |
| Topological Polar Surface Area | 25.500 Ų |
| Heavy Atom Count | 11 |
| Formal Charge | 0 |
| Complexity | 120.000 |
| Isotope Atom Count | 0 |
| Defined Atom Stereocenter Count | 0 |
| Undefined Atom Stereocenter Count | 0 |
| Defined Bond Stereocenter Count | 0 |
| Undefined Bond Stereocenter Count | 0 |
| The total count of all stereochemical bonds | 0 |
| Covalently-Bonded Unit Count | 1 |
